The former Tanjong Pagar Railway Station will open its doors to the public on Good Friday from 9am to 6pm, announced the Singapore Land Authority (SLA).

Back in February, SLA said the historical landmark would be open to visitors on all public holidays, starting from the second day of the Lunar New Year.

This is to allow more people to visit the national monument and enjoy the surroundings.

Meanwhile, visitors have been reminded to keep the area clean and litter free.

To help preserve the monument, several activities will not be allowed on the premises including cycling and roller blading, smoking, consumption of alcohol and bringing pets (except for guide dogs).
